It is therefore important to consider if bunk beds are appropriate for your children&#39;s room before purchasing. Safety Kids&#39; low bunk beds are safe if they&#39;re positioned in the room, and your children adhere to the rules you have set for them. This may include not playing around or on the top bunk, taking care when climbing the ladder, putting toys away and using it as a place to sleep only. Read the Full Post is crucial that your children are aware of and follow these rules, particularly when they have friends staying with them. Children who play on or around the bunk bed run higher chance of falling, hitting their heads or becoming tangled in the bedding. Avoid placing bunk beds close to ceiling fans, heaters, blinds, or windows. You can also fix the bunk bed to the wall to reduce the risk of it tipping over. The most frequent injuries to bunk beds are concussions resulting from falls. The most deadly, however, are from strangulation. Make sure your children don&#39;t hang clothing, belts or jump ropes from the bunk bed. These pose a strangulation risk and could cause injury when they are caught in between or on the headboards, railings, and footboards. Bunk bed safety can be further improved with extra accessories like straps or mattress retaining bars and non-slip pads for ladder steps, and nightlights for safer night-time access to the upper bunk. Also, you should check regularly that the gaps between the loft bed or bunk are not more than 3.5 inches to minimize the chance of your child being trapped between them. It can also liven up their sleepovers and make it more enjoyable for friends to come over to stay the night. Safety Bunk beds can be made safer by following the right rules and practical precautions. Parents must remind their children to adhere to these rules frequently because they are more likely to forget them as they get older. This is especially crucial when children are hosting a sleepover with friends because they might not be as well-versed in the rules. Bunk beds can cause injuries ranging from minor bruising and bumps to concussions or brain bleeds. These are serious medical conditions that require emergency treatment. Serious injuries can also be the result of the collapse of a bunk bed which could trap children underneath or cause them to fall on hard surfaces. These injuries can be avoided by building bunk beds in accordance with national safety standards and by making sure that children are aware of these dangers and know how to avoid them. Ensure that bunks have guardrails on both sides, and that the gaps aren&#39;t larger than 3.5 inches to prevent strangulation. It is also essential to keep the bunks clear from hanging ceiling fans or light fixtures and to put a nightlight near the ladder for bathroom trips at night. It&#39;s also recommended that children use the ladder to climb into and out of their beds, instead of chairs or other furniture. It&#39;s an excellent idea to make sure that all bunk-related items such as ladders anchoring kits screws and bolts do not contain toxic substances, such as di-(2-ethylhexyl) the phthalate (DEHP), dibutyl phthalate (DBP), the benzylbutyl phthalate (BBP) diisononyl-phthalate (DINP) diisobutyl-phthalate (DIBP), or dicyclohexyl phthalate (DCHP).
